Currently, there is no support for creating a ClusterExtension that can install a bundle that is in a private registry and requires authentication. This epic is scoped for enabling that support. There are a couple different approaches that should be supported:
- A global pull secret
- Note: this should also be done in Catalogd, which currently has support for direct references to a
Secret
- A direct reference to a
Secret
Brief: https://docs.google.com/document/d/14abNwdBEe6bGaLczGIlgYR9ghz6gbp_qene_7znIa8o/edit
RFC: https://docs.google.com/document/d/1BXD6kj5zXHcGiqvJOikU2xs8kV26TPnzEKp6n7TKD4M/edit
Currently, there is no support for creating a
ClusterExtensionthat can install a bundle that is in a private registry and requires authentication. This epic is scoped for enabling that support. There are a couple different approaches that should be supported:SecretSecretBrief: https://docs.google.com/document/d/14abNwdBEe6bGaLczGIlgYR9ghz6gbp_qene_7znIa8o/edit
RFC: https://docs.google.com/document/d/1BXD6kj5zXHcGiqvJOikU2xs8kV26TPnzEKp6n7TKD4M/edit